The russian novelist, short story writer and playwright, ivan turgenev is celebrated for the short story collection a sportsmans sketches, a milestone of russian realism, and his novel fathers and sons, now regarded as one of the major works of nineteenth century fiction. Ivan sergeyevich turgenev 18181883 was a russian novelist, short story writer, and playwright, best known for his novel fathers and sons. His father, a cavalry colonel, died when he was 15, and he was raised by his abusive mother, who ruled her 5000 serfs ruthlessly with a whip. On the eve is the third novel by famous russian writer ivan turgenev, best known for his short stories and the novel fathers and sons. A romantic story of illfated love, on the eve is set against the background of the social concerns of russia in the 1850s.
It is set in the prior decade by the end of the novel, the crimean war 185356 has already broken out.
